  • Registered Users, Registered Users 2 Posts: 13,762 ✭✭✭✭Inquitus


    Just wondering if people could give me their experiences on the best apps for the following tasks (preferably free or cheap)?

    1. Football scores (is there an official sky sports centre app?) Google Scoreboard for multisports
    2. Camera related applications Qik allows nifty and fast sharing of Vids to youtube etc
    3. Web browser For me the default browser does best, but Skyfire and others are well regarded
    4. Remote access to PC logmein ignition when its out of beta
    5. Divx / video player nothing if you find something reliable let me know
    6. Social networking / gmail default HTC Sense and Android Apps
    7. Music playing software
    8. Calculating distance travelled plotting routes etc. (for cycling / jogging)
    9. Sat nav (for out of car use) Google Navigation is free
    10. Any apps for downloading youtube, flash video etc.
    11. eBay
    12. MS Office Viewer Documents to Go, tho the full version is paid and you dont want to be dealing with big files
    13. PDF Software Acrobat reader
    14. SMS software (similar to Eirtext etc. possibly cabbage?) Handcent for GSM Messages, cabbage for webtexts from your phone
    15. Managing data usage 3G Watchdog does me
    16. Managing on / off of 3G, wireless, bluetooth etc. Locale is the best criteria specific profile manager uses location among many other things, very versatile, silent at work, Wifi only on at home, BT only at home etc. anything is possible, costs $10 though
    17. Weather Default Sense

    Just wondering if people could give me their experiences on the best apps for the following tasks (preferably free or cheap)?
    1. Football scores (is there an official sky sports centre app?)Google Scoreboard I guess or Soccer Livescores.No Sky one yet
    2. Camera related applications Could use some more info as to what youre really looking for but id agree with Qik for streaming
    3. Web browser. Stock, Skyfire, Dolphin.Everyone has preferences
    4. Remote access to PC. Logmein Ignition or Phone to PC
    5. Divx / video player. Theres apparently a chinese one but I havnt found it yet.
    6. Social networking / gmail. Facebook, Bloo(facebook), Twitter, Gmail App rules all
    7. Music playing software. Tunewiki would be my favourite or Mixzing
    8. Calculating distance travelled plotting routes etc. (for cycling / jogging) Runkeeper(theres free and pro.Not sure of the differences)
    9. Sat nav (for out of car use). Google Navigation for Data, Navigon or CoPilot for downloaded maps
    10. Any apps for downloading youtube, flash video etc. Theres Tubedroid but im not sure if its on the market anymore.It was free so people could have it just online to download
    11. eBay. Pkt Autions would be better then the official eBay atm
    12. MS Office Viewer Documents to go
    13. PDF Software. Adobe have a free official one
    14. SMS software (similar to Eirtext etc. possibly cabbage?)Cabbage for web, Handcent for standard usage
    15. Managing data usage. 3G Watchdog I agree with
    16. Managing on / off of 3G, wireless, bluetooth etc.. Locale is excellent or you coult just use the power control widget and change whenever you want
    17. Weather. Weatherbug, The Weather Channel or built into HTC Sense
